Facts about Elon, NC
Elon is a town located in Alamance County, North Carolina, United States. It covers an area of approximately 4.2 square miles and has a population of around 12,000 residents. Elon is best known for being the home of Elon University, which significantly influences the town's culture and economy.
The town's economy is supported by the university, along with industries such as healthcare, education, retail, and local businesses. Elon offers a range of amenities, including parks, dining options, shops, and cultural attractions, providing a vibrant community atmosphere.
Geography
Elon is situated in the central part of North Carolina, near Burlington and Alamance. The town's terrain is characterized by gently rolling hills and green spaces. It is well-connected to major highways, including Interstate 40 and U.S. Route 70, providing easy access to nearby cities.
The area features several parks and recreational areas, such as Beth Schmidt Park and the Elon University campus itself, which offers amenities like walking trails, sports fields, and gardens. Additionally, Elon is close to natural attractions like Lake Mackintosh and the Haw River.
Demographics
Elon has a diverse population, with a significant portion of students, faculty, and staff from Elon University. The town's median household income is above the national average, reflecting a mix of middle-income and upper-income households. Elon is home to families, university students, and professionals attracted by its educational opportunities and community spirit.
The racial makeup of Elon is predominantly White, followed by Black or African American, Hispanic or Latino, and Asian residents. The town has a strong sense of community, with active neighborhood associations, civic organizations, and university-related events. Educational opportunities are abundant, with Elon University being a central institution in the town.
